Responsibilities Include

  • Evaluate mental health diagnosis, create, and implement a treatment plan, complete ongoing documentation including further diagnosis, treatment plan reviews, and case notes according to company policy
  • Provide excellent customer service for clients and collaborate with a dynamic team to further the mission of filling gaps in our community
  • Utilize creativity in interventions to help clients achieve and exceed goals
  • Prepare and submit individual documentation for each session per company guidelines and protocol
  • For Full-Time status clinicians must maintain a caseload of a minimum of 25 client visits per week
  • Coordinate services with case managers, families, work personnel, medical personnel, other Ellie staff, and school staff as needed
  • Attend and participate in all clinical staff meetings and trainings
  • Other stuff we probably forgot to add but just as meaningful and important to your role ;)

Required Qualifications And Skills

  • Candidates are required to have a master’s degree in one of the behavioral sciences or related fields from an accredited college or university and on track to obtain licensure in their designated field
  • Candidates should have clinical licensure (LMFT, LPCC, LICSW, LP etc.)
  • Required experience with completing DAs, treatment plans and clinical case notes
  • Effective written and verbal communication skills
  • Ability to demonstrate and model stable, appropriate boundaries with clients
  • Ability to complete and submit documentation of services and other documents in a timely manner
  • Comfort and familiarity working with a diverse client base
  • Proficient in the use of Office 365 and Electronic Health Record systems (Valant experience a plus!)
  • Fully Licensed Clinicians will ideally be credentialed with insurance panels

Company Structure

Ellie is a socially responsible for-profit business, which allows us to be flexible and responsive to our community’s needs. Many mental health and wellness-focused companies are non-profits or government agencies, which rely on the general public, grants, or large donors for funding. This model often results in little creativity and lower compensation for employees, promoting a work culture that just makes people feel “blah.”

Feeling blah doesn’t help employees stay motivated, engaged, or even in their jobs for a very long time! So we created a new model: one that puts flexibility, innovative decision-making, creativity, and our people first, while remaining a socially conscious and responsible for-profit business focused on changing how we treat mental health.
